HELPFUL HINT It is difficult to hold the needle perfectly still if your hand is waving unsupported in the air. Make certain that the hand and wrist of the hand used to grasp the needle hub are securely supported by resting the wrist on the patient’s forehead or chest (Fig. 3–6). Next, attempt to advance the wire into the vein. After removing the syringe, an assistant should have the wire ready, placing the tip of the wire close to the needle hub and holding the back end of the wire.

The choice of drapes is based on personal preference and costs. For internal jugular vein punctures and subclavian vein punctures, we prefer brachial drapes, which are large enough to cover a large area, but small enough to be removed easily from the patient’s face. The drape may be cut away from over the patient’s face by an assistant.
